Abstract

In this note, the state estimation problem for a class of short-time switched linear systems is investigated. By incorporating the concept of finite-time stability, an observer is designed to ensure the error dynamics finite-time stable in the short-time switching interval under the general asynchronous switching whereas synchronous switching mode is its special case. A numerical example is provided to illustrate the effectiveness of our study in this paper.
